87-(36.5-11.5)*(-3)+9 simplify using order of operations
OLga [1]
Remember PEMDAS 
Do parentheses, results in 25. So whats left is 87-25*(-3)+9
Then you multiply -25 by -3, answer is 75.        87+75+9
Add all of them up.                                                171
The answer is 171!
